Default 5pt racing harness conversion for the S's seats

I love the 5pt racing seats from companies like sparco, but don't want to give up my beloved leather seats. Any feasability in getting someone to make an aftermarket conversion kit. Another possibility is sending your seats away to have it done, that or an exchange for already done seats. Is it realistic?

I have seen 4pt harnesses used with the OEM seats and without modification but not a 5pt. After the plastic head rest piece is removed the top two straps were placed through the hole and the plastic section was then replaced. Not sure how comfortable it is or how much stress will be caused on the seats upper section just given info on what I have seen.

not advisable, not recommended, and I would do my best to talk you out of it if you wanted to buy the harnesses. its a safety issue - and without 1) proper roll over protection and 2) proper mounting points, you are playing with your life if something should happen. of course nothing 'should' happen, but it does.

but to answer your question, nope, no way to do it with the stock seats. maybe some heafty modification that would be difficult to justify the cost. the belts will either work 'ok' for you if you have extremely wide shoulders and a large torso, or they will pinch your neck. both of those reasons are because the harnesses will need to be mounted outside the eyehole or inside the eyehole of the seat.
